Astro_22 By D.K. Wilkinson
Astro_22 as released is a starter program which accurately
calculates the position of the planets, cusps and zodiac positions
to within 30 seconds of arc. I intend to increase the usefulness
of the program to eventually cover all aspects of the subject
which will appeal to professional as well as novice astrologers
not wishing to pay £200+ for a decent package. Several add-on
modules are already available for release and details of these
can be found in the pull-down GEM Menu against Astro_22., and the
text file 'ADD_ONS.DOC'.
The program is simple to use and is very fast. To calculate a
chart, click on the 'New Chart' option from the menu and enter the
information as prompted. Latitude and longitude positions for any
place of birth can be obtained from a decent atlas. Zone Time
is hours +/- Greenwich time. For the UK this entry will be +00
Hrs. Those who have no knowledge of astrology will be able to
find out what their particular chart means by borrowing a book
from the public library and spending a hour or so reading up on
the subject. The hard part of astrology, namely calculating the
chart, is done by Astro_22.
The more experienced astrologers will immediately recognise the
potential of Astro_22 and will derive great pleasure from its use.
The shaded menu options are disabled, intended for use with the
add-on modules.

The colour palette is pre set up for colour monitors
using the accessory "CONTROL.ACC". Each has his own preference of
suitable colours for displayiny the different chart items
therefore, I have not program controlled all the main colours so
that the user can experiment with the control panel to find
the most suitable mix relevent to himself or herself. How to use
the control panel is explained in the Atari Handbook. The colour
setting can be saved by exiting Astro_22 and then saving the
desktop.
The astrological symbols were designed using a copy of the
excellent Fontkit program by Jeremy Hughes. The accessory
'Fontselect', also by jeremy Hughes, is used by Astro_22 to load
the screen fonts at boot up. If you have a copy of Fontkit, feel
free to experiment with the supplied symbols found in the 'Fonts'
Çfolder. If you do not have a copy, most PD Companies can supply
you with it at a modest cost.
